WebYumalundi means Hello in the Ngunnawal language. The Ngunnawal people are the traditional owners of the Canberra region. Gurumba bigi pronounced Goo-roo-mba big-i which means G’day in Yugara – one of the Aboriginal languages spoken the Greater Brisbane area (west to Ipswich and the Lockyer Valley). A Welcome to Country can only be performed by a traditional owner, welcoming you to this or her own country. An Acknowledgement of Country can be performed by anyone, Indigenous or non-Indigenous, as a way to acknowledge that you respect the traditional people of …
